Output 4a69b1b74eae5a2687f57d0396cb9c0f17a6104e2776a941de880e375194d682:1

value
1018429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418c453293b9a882b21132c9db4126ca4e42f7fe OP_EQUAL
address
37fbtAUmm9WkACtdvPPkbtU8BJSCWWVB6A
transaction
4a69b1b74eae5a2687f57d0396cb9c0f17a6104e2776a941de880e375194d682
confirmations
400508
spent
true